3M Co-Pittsboro is an EPA Toxics Release Inventory reporter in Moncure, NC, in the nonmetallic mineral product sector. It reported 31.8K lbs of releases across 5 chemicals in 2023, and 169.1K lbs in total across its 2019-2023 reporting years. That ranks 3,532 of 25,986 TRI facilities nationwide by cumulative reported pounds, counting each facility over however many years it has filed. Annual disclosure change

What changed: EPA TRI 2023 reporting year

2022 → 2023
  • 3M Co-Pittsboro's total reported releases rose from 23.4 thousand lb in 2022 to 31.8 thousand lb in 2023, based on EPA TRI filings.
  • 3M Co-Pittsboro's off-site transfers rose from 3.2 thousand lb in 2022 to 7.5 thousand lb in 2023, based on EPA TRI filings.
  • 3M Co-Pittsboro's land releases rose from 20.2 thousand lb in 2022 to 24.3 thousand lb in 2023, based on EPA TRI filings.
